What is a Bedside Cot?
A bedside Cot Bed With Draw, likewise known as a co-sleeper or side sleeper, is a type of crib that is created to connect firmly to the side of the moms and dad's bed. It allows for easy access to the baby throughout the night while providing a separate sleeping space. This design supports safe sleep practices while assisting in nighttime feeding and comforting.

Promotes Safe Sleep
Bedside cots comply with safe sleep guidelines as the infant has its own sleeping space. This separation decreases the risk of suffocation and getting too hot, which are common concerns with conventional co-sleeping arrangements.
2. Enhances Bonding
Having a bedside cot permits parents to react rapidly to their baby's requirements throughout the night. This distance can strengthen the parent-child bond and encourage an emotional connection.
3. Helps With Nighttime Feeding
For breastfeeding mothers, bedside cots present the perfect option for nighttime feedings without the requirement to completely get up or get out of bed.
4. Reduces Stress
The close range enables parents to feel more at ease, knowing they can look at their baby without getting out of bed. This plan can result in a more restful sleep for both the moms and dad and the kid.
5. Versatile Use
Numerous bedside cots can change into standalone cribs, making them a long-lasting financial investment in your child's sleeping arrangements. They can often be used up until the kid is around 6-12 months old, depending upon the particular model.
Considerations When Choosing a Bedside Cot
When buying a bedside cot, it is important to think about various aspects:
1. Security Standards
Ensure that the cot adheres to regional safety guidelines. Try to find brands that have actually been checked and certified for security.
2. Bed mattress Quality
The quality of the bed mattress is essential for the health and convenience of the baby. A company, helpful mattress is essential to avoid issues such as SIDS (Sudden Infant Death Syndrome).
3. Budget plan
Bedside cots can be found in a series of prices. Set a spending plan and consider the finest value for the features you need.
4. Size and Space
Make certain to inspect the dimensions of the cot and make sure that it fits well beside your bed. If space is a concern, choose a model that is quickly portable or collapsible.
5. Ease of Assembly
Some cots are more complicated to assemble than others. Look for models that are user-friendly, particularly if you anticipate moving the cot more than once.

Are bedside cots safe for newborns?
Yes, bedside cots are created to provide a safe sleeping environment for newborns, offered they satisfy security requirements and are set up properly.
2. At what age can my baby shift from a bedside cot?
Normally, babies can use bedside cots till they have to do with 6-12 months old or up until they can pull themselves up or roll over. Constantly describe the manufacturer's standards.
3. Can bedside cots be used for traveling?
Many bedside cots are portable and foldable, making them suitable for travel. However, make sure that the particular design you select is designed for easy transport.
4. How do I make sure the bedside cot is secure to my bed?
Follow the producer's directions carefully for connecting the cot to your bed. A lot of designs have systems to secure them firmly.
5. Can I use a routine crib instead of a bedside cot?
While a routine crib offers a safe sleeping space, it does not supply the same benefit for nighttime access and bonding that bedside cots do.
